|
转给你一篇私人珍藏的文章,呵呵。
刷3块intel 559网卡(刷成服务器网卡和最新的boot agent)- -
前几天,买来3块intel82559芯片的网卡,板卡本身一模一样(除了那几个纸标签),插到XP电脑上,一块是认成 HP NET Server卡 ,一块认成 INTEL PRO MANAGERMENT卡 ,一块认成 COMPAQ 3123卡 ,看着是很不爽, 干脆都刷成INTEL PRO/100 S+ Server Apapter ,这样既可以使用INTEL最新的驱动,又可以使用INTEL服务器网卡的一些特别功能,比如多网卡绑定 等等。
再加一项,把intel最新的无盘ROM都刷新到最新的 pxe2.1 (084)版本。 :)
网上下载到 intel的eeupdate.exe 用来刷新网卡型号, 这个程序我在intel没有找到,最后在网上其它地址下载的
去INTEL下载到最新的bootagent 程序 ibautil.exe(去intel网站查找 boot agent ,最后让你下载一个PROBOOT.exe的自解压包,里面就包含了ibautil.exe等一套工具) 最新的是4.1版本
刷新方法
1: 刷新网卡型号
在纯DOS下 执行eeupdate.exe 可以看到 程序列出了系统中现有的intel网卡的相关信息,如果有多块网卡
就分成了多行 前面加上了 数字 1 , 2来区分
运行 eeupdate -all -dump
生成一个以MAC为文件名的eep文件如B747A6E4.EEP,内容类似如下
D000 47B7 E4A6 0403 0000 0201 4701 0000
7351 9001 44A2 1060 8086 0000 0000 0000
0000 0000 0000 0000 0000 0000 0000 0000
0000 0000 0000 0000 0000 0000 0000 0000
0000 0000 0000 0000 0000 0000 0000 0000
0000 0000 0000 0000 0000 0000 0000 0000
012C 4000 410F 4007 0000 0000 0000 0000
0000 0000 0000 0000 0000 0000 0000 56DA
为了让你的网卡变成服务器网卡, 只需要把0403 位置对应原来数字改称0403,把 1060 8086位置对应的数字 改成1060 8086 保存既可
网上没有提到 8086位置的数字需要修改,只说是8086代表x86系统结构,但我发现OEM版intel网卡8086位置都是其它数字, intel品牌的才是8086,所以这个一定要把原有数字改成8086.才能成功
然后 eeupdate -all -d B747A6E4.EEP
如果你有多个网卡在系统内 上面的参数后面都加上 -nic=1 ( 数字1为eeupdate列出的对应的网卡) 来操作.
好了, 刷新完毕,重新启动系统进入windows, 系统提示发现 新硬件 NTEL PRO/100 S+ Server Apapter
OK! 如果8086位置数字不对,没有改过来,会提示发现inter 8255x base 卡的
安装intel最新驱动10.1版本.
看,是不是多了很多功能,advance里面居然包括了tcpip off load功能,非常不错
2:刷新无盘ROM
在纯DOS下 执行ibautil.exe -? 可以看到帮助
执行 ibautil.exe -up
会提示是否备份原有rom,按Y 自动备份,然后自动开始升级rom
升级完毕. 开机 网卡引导,出现 intel boot agent pxe 2.1 ( 084) RPL 2.77 Crtl + S 等等...... 就OK了
说明: 所有刷新操作在DOS下进行,要不,程序会找不到网卡的. |
|